What Is the Process of Selecting Academy Awards Presenters?

The selection process for Academy Awards presenters is often shrouded in mystery. The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ences considers various factors when choosing who will take the stage. Key considerations include:

  • Current relevance and popularity in the film industry
  • Previous involvement in the Academy Awards
  • Potential for memorable interactions with nominees and winners

What Are Some Memorable Moments Involving Academy Awards Presenters?

The Academy Awards have seen countless memorable moments involving presenters. Here are a few highlights:

  • When Jack Lemmon presented the Best Picture award in 1997, his heartfelt tribute to the nominees left a lasting impression.
  • Whoopi Goldberg's comedic timing and impersonations have made her one of the most beloved presenters in Oscar history.
  • During the 2017 ceremony, La La Land was mistakenly announced as the Best Picture winner due to a mix-up with envelopes, creating a shocking moment that involved presenters Warren Beatty and Faye Dunaway.
